Volleyball Recap: Valhalla Norsemen vs. Christian Patriots

Valhalla lost against Christian last Saturday,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Wednesday. The Valhalla Norsemen fell just short of the Christian Patriots by a score of 3-2. While the Norsemen didn't get the win, they did start the game off strong, beating the Patriots 25-19 in the first set.

Valhalla wouldn't go down easily and took Christian into a fifth set but they suffered a heartbreaking eight-point loss.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 19-25, 25-17, 25-16, 23-25, 15-7.

Valhalla's offense was headlined by Gno Casanova and Andrew Ramzi, who picked up six kills apiece. Casanova really made an impact as he also led the team in assists with 22. He was also solid from the service line: he led the team with three aces.

Leading Christian to victory were McKade Mathson and Trae Pheasant. Mathson had 21 digs and four aces, while Pheasant had 18 assists and 15 digs. Those four aces gave Mathson a new career-high. Jack McGinnis was another key player, getting 18 digs.

Valhalla's defeat dropped their record down to 2-6. As for Christian,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 4-5.

Valhalla did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 3-2 victory against Liberty Charter on the 6th. As for Christian,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 3-1 win against San Diego Academy on the 6th.
